Machine Learning Benchmarks Compare Energy Consumption
Machine learning (ML) is becoming increasingly popular in many applications, ranging from miniature Internet of Things (IoT) devices to massive data centers. For various reasons like real-time expectations, must-have offline operation, battery-saving purposes, or even security and privacy the most optimal is to run ML algorithms and data processing right at the edge where the data is being generated. These low-power IoT devices could be embedded microcontrollers, wireless SoCs, or intelligence integrated into a sensor device.
To achieve this, semiconductor product manufacturers need small, low-power processors or microcontrollers enable to run the necessary ML software in an efficient way, sometimes supported with HW acceleration built into the chip. Evaluating the performance of a particular device is not straightforward, as its effectiveness in an ML application is more important than raw number-crunching.
To help, MLCommons™, an open engineering consortium, has developed three benchmarking suites to compare ML offerings from different vendors. MLCommons focuses on collaborative engineering work to benefit the machine learning industry through benchmarks, metrics, public datasets, and best practices.
These benchmark suites, called MLPerf™, measure the performance of ML systems at inference when applying a trained ML model to new data. The benchmarks also optionally measure the energy used to complete the inference task. As the benchmarks are open source and peer-reviewed, they provide an objective, impartial test of performance and energy efficiency.
Of the three benchmarks available from MLCommons, SILICON LABS has submitted a solution for the MLPerf Tiny suite. MLPerf Tiny is aimed at the smallest devices with low power consumption, typically used in deeply embedded applications such as the IoT or intelligent sensing.
The Benchmarking Tests
MLCommons recently conducted a round of its MLPerf Tiny 1.0 benchmarking, and 16 different systems were submitted for analysis by different vendors.
Customers typically look for more than raw performance in these ultra-low-power ML systems. They also focus on power consumption and often prioritize the energy a system uses to perform a task as the most important metric, especially in the case of aiming to create battery-powered applications.
For representative testing, the benchmarks included ML models for five different scenarios (see Table 1): keyword spotting, visual wake words, image classification, and anomaly detection. Each scenario uses a specific dataset and ML model to simulate real-world applications. The benchmark suites are designed to test the hardware, software, and machine learning models used. In each case, the testing measured the latency of a single inference to show how quickly the task was completed. The test could also optionally measure the energy used.
The Silicon Labs System Benchmarked
Silicon Labs submitted its EFR32MG24 Multiprotocol Wireless System on Chip (SoC) for benchmarking. The SoC includes one Arm Cortex®-M33 core (78MHz, 1.5MB of Flash / 256kB of RAM) and a Silicon Labs AI/ML accelerator subsystem. It supports multiple 2.4GHz RF protocols, including Bluetooth Low Energy (BLE), Bluetooth mesh, Matter, OpenThread, and Zigbee. It’s ideal for mesh IoT wireless applications, such as smart homes, lighting, and building automation. This compact development platform provides a simple, time-saving path for AI/ ML development.
The SoC was running TensorFlowLite for Microcontrollers software, which enables ML inference models to run on microcontrollers and other low-power devices with small memories. It used optimized neural network kernels from the CMSIS-NN library in the Silicon Labs Gecko Software Development Kit (SDK).
The Results
The MLPerf™ Tiny v1.0 benchmark results highlight the efficiency of the on-chip accelerator in Silicon Labs’ EFR32MG24 platform. Inferencing calculations are offloaded from the main CPU, allowing it to execute other tasks or even be placed in sleep mode to provide further power savings.
It’s essential to meet the growing needs of AI/ML-enhanced low-power wireless IoT solutions, allowing devices to stay in the field for up to ten years on a single coin-cell battery. These latest results show an improvement of 1.5 to 2x increase in speed and a 40-80% reduction in energy consumption compared to a selection of other benchmarked AI/ML models from the previous Tiny v0.7 results.
As ML becomes more widely used in embedded IoT applications, this ability to run inferences with low power consumption is essential – and will enable product designers to apply ML in new use cases and different devices.
- |
- +1 赞 0
- 收藏
- 评论 0
本文由玄子转载自Silicon Labs Blogs,原文标题为:Machine Learning Benchmarks Compare Energy Consumption,本站所有转载文章系出于传递更多信息之目的,且明确注明来源,不希望被转载的媒体或个人可与我们联系,我们将立即进行删除处理。
相关研发服务和供应服务
相关推荐
【应用】地平线新一代AIoT AI SOC X3ME00IBGTMB-H成功用于AI分析盒子,提供5TOPS的算力
在盒子的主控方面,客户采用的是地平线的新一代AIoT AI SOC 旭日3系列X3ME00IBGTMB-H,这是地平线针对 AIoT 场景,推出的新一代低功耗、高性能的智能芯片,集成了地平线最先进的伯努利2.0 架构引擎( BPU® ),可提供5TOPS的算力。
应用方案 发布时间 : 2023-04-22
【应用】地平线推出基于AI SoC X3M的扫地机方案,提供配套TROS操作系统和AI算法
地平线推出基于Sunrise®旭日芯片的扫地机方案,提供芯片+操作系统+算法的完整解决方案,实现更智能、更稳定、更主动的智能扫地机应用。
应用方案 发布时间 : 2022-07-05
Z-Wave and Z-Wave Long Range 700/800 SDK 7.21.4 GA Gecko SDK Suite 4.4
型号- BRD4204A,BRD4206A,EFR32ZG23B,BRD4204D,BRD4400C,EFR32ZG23A,BRD4200A,BRD4204B,BRD4204C,BRD4202A,BRD2603A,BRD4208A,EFR32ZG28B,BRD4210A,ZGM230SA,ZGM230SB,BRD4205A,BRD2705,BRD4205B,BRD4207A,BRD4201A,BRD4401C,BRD2603,BRD4401B,ZGM130S,BRD4209A,BRD2705A,EFR32ZG14
【应用】算力高达5TOPS的SOC X3ME00IBGTMB-H用于双目AI相机设计,满足输入图像的图像信号处理要求
某客户做一款双目AI相机,需要跑自己的识别算法,用于识别一些物体,算法是自研的,视频输出部分要求分辨率达到4K级别。在相机处理器上需要一款有一定算力和多路视频处理能力的芯片,客户采用地平线的旭日3系列AI SOC X3ME00IBGTMB-H,该款芯片性能强大,算力和视频处理能力均能满足需求。
应用方案 发布时间 : 2023-03-26
EFR32BG24 Wireless SoC Family Data Sheet
型号- EFR32BG24B110F1536IM48-B,EFR32BG24B210F1024IM48-B,EFR32BG24A020F1024IM40-B,EFR32XG24,EFR32BG24A010F1024IM48-B,EFR32BG24A020F1024IM48-B,EFR32BG24 FAMILY,EFR32BG24B220F1024IM48-B,EFR32BG24B020F1536IM48-BR,EFR32,EFR32BG24,EFR32BG24A010F1024IM40-B
携手无线技术联盟扩展IoT战略-全面布局创新技术和人工智能+安全
物联网(IoT)无线连接技术时刻在发生新变化。近日,物联传媒记者在深圳物联网展会期间特别采访了Silicon Labs亚太区生态高级经理刘俊先生,此次访谈紧密围绕公司在刚结束的深圳物联网展中亮相的前沿科技成果,深入讨论了技术创新、产品优势、应用前景等话题。
原厂动态 发布时间 : 2024-10-23
芯科科技BG2x系列蓝牙SoC引领可穿戴设备创新,打造AI健康生活新纪元
随着人们对个人健康和智能生活的追求不断升温,可穿戴设备市场呈现出蓬勃发展的态势。在这个充满机遇与挑战的领域,Silicon Labs(亦称“芯科科技”)凭借其深厚的技术积累和敏锐的市场洞察,成为了行业的佼佼者。近日,芯科科技的家居和生活业务部可穿戴和生活业务经理Pranay Dixit参与了EEPW电子产品世界的访谈,就可穿戴设备市场的现状、公司战略以及技术创新等方面进行了深入探讨。
应用方案 发布时间 : 2024-04-30
EFR32MG21 Multiprotocol Wireless SoC Family Data Sheet
型号- EFR32MG21A020F512IM32-B,EFR32MG21B020F512IM32-D,EFR32MG21B020F512IM32-B,EFR32MG21A010F512IM32-B,EFR32MG21B010F512IM32-B,EFR32MG21A010F768IM32-D,EFR32MG21B020F1024IM32-B,EFR32MG21B010F1024IM32-B,EFR32MG21B010F768IM32-D,EFR32MG21B010F768IM32-B,EFR32MG21B010F1024IM32-D,EFR32MG21A010F768IM32-B,EFR32MG21B020F1024IM32-D,EFR32MG21B010F512IM32-D,EFR32MG21,EFR32MG21A010F512IM32-D,EFR32MG21B020F768IM32-B,EFR32MG21A020F768IM32-D,EFR32MG21B020F768IM32-D,EFR32MG21A020F768IM32-B,EFR32MG21A020F512IM32-D,EFR32MG21A010F1024IM32-B,EFR32MG21A020F1024IM32-D,EFR32MG21A020F1024IM32-B,EFR32MG21A010F1024IM32-D
AI融合物联网大势所趋,ML语音识别和手势控制应用分享
芯科科技作为智能、安全物联网无线连接领域的开拓者,正在致力于将AI/ML带到边缘。我们对创新的承诺导致了开创性的解决方案,它赋予资源受限的设备如MCU具备更丰富的智能功能。
原厂动态 发布时间 : 2024-09-30
EFR32BG24 CSP Wireless SoC Family Data Sheet
型号- EFR32BG24B310F1536IJ42-BR,EFR32XG24,EFR32BG24 FAMILY,EFR32,EFR32BG24
EFR32MG24 Wireless SoC Family Data Sheet
型号- EFR32MG24A020F1536IM48-B,EFR32MG24A410F1536IM40-B,EFR32XG24,EFR32MG24B020F1024IM48-B,EFR32MG24A420F1536IM48-B,EFR32MG24A010F1536IM40-B,EFR32MG24A410F1536IM48-B,EFR32MG24B010F1024IM48-B,EFR32MG24A420F1536IM40-B,EFR32MG24A020F1536IM40-B,EFR32,EFR32MG24A010F1536IM48-B,EFR32MG24A110F1024IM48-B,EFR32MG24A010F1024IM48-B,EFR32MG24,EFR32MG24B010F1536IM40-B,EFR32MG24A020F1024IM48-B,EFR32MG24B020F1536IM40-B,EFR32MG24A010F1024IM40-B,EFR32MG24B210F1536IM48-B,EFR32MG24B310F1536IM48-B,EFR32MG24A020F1024IM40-B,EFR32MG24 FAMILY,EFR32MG24B220F1536IM48-B,EFR32MG24B110F1536IM48-B,EFR32MG24B120F1536IM48-B,EFR32MG24B020F1536IM48-BR,EFR32MG24B010F1536IM48-B,EFR32MG24A021F1024IM40-B,EFR32MG24B020F1536IM48-B
EFR32BG26 Wireless Gecko SoC Family Data Short
型号- EFR32BG26B320F2048IM68-B,EFR32BG26B010F2048IM68-AR,EFR32BG26B320F2048IM48-B,EFR32BG26B310F2048IM48-B,EFR32BG26B310F1024IM68-B,EFR32BG26B310F2048IM68-B,EFR32BG26B310F2048IL136-B,EFR32BG26B320F1024IM68-B,EFR32BG26,EFR32BG26B510F3200IL136-B,EFR32BG26B510F3200IM48-B,EFR32BG26B510F3200IM68-B,EFR32BG26B310F1024IL136-B
【经验】Silicon Labs Zigbee SoC芯片EM35X系列烧录工具ISA3的配置
ISA3仿真器是Silicon labs的zigbee芯片EM35X系列的开发工具之一,主要用于编程调试数据分析等,本文介绍其使用前的一些基本配置。
设计经验 发布时间 : 2017-09-13
【经验】地平线SOC X3M ai express中增加uvc输出图像分辨率方法
地平线X3M在做UVC摄像头时,经常有输出多种分辨率或者定制分辨率的需求,本文介绍地平线SOC X3M ai express中增加uvc输出图像分辨率方法
设计经验 发布时间 : 2022-10-12
AI看奥运 | 从巴黎奥运会看人工智能的应用和发展,美格智能高算力AI模组为端侧AI提供通用智算底座
2024巴黎奥运会火热空前,从开幕式到金牌争夺战,本届奥运会的关注热度持续攀升。与往届不同的是低延时、高算力的AI技术以亮眼表现出现在大众的视野,为AI技术的广泛应用和创新发展奠定了坚实的基础。美格智能持续投入高算力产品及AI技术在各行各业的应用落地,在业内率先推出了高算力AI模组、SoC阵列服务器解决方案等各类算力产品及解决方案。
应用方案 发布时间 : 2024-08-14
电子商城
品牌:SILICON LABS
品类:Wireless Gecko SoC
价格:¥8.1764
现货: 104,128
品牌:SILICON LABS
品类:Mighty Gecko Multi-Protocol Wireless SoC
价格:¥27.0929
现货: 90,767
品牌:SILICON LABS
品类:Wireless Gecko SoC
价格:¥10.4994
现货: 61,779
品牌:SILICON LABS
品类:Wireless Gecko SoC
价格:¥11.5212
现货: 59,367
现货市场
登录 | 立即注册
提交评论